DETAILED DESCRIPTION OF THE INVENTION (a) Field of Industrial Use The present invention includes a filter and a hot-water supply of a beverage by pumping hot water into a cartridge-shaped raw material container that contains extraction raw materials such as coffee and tea. The present invention relates to a beverage extraction device for extracting.

(B) Conventional technology Such a beverage extraction device is, for example, as disclosed in Japanese Utility Model Publication No. 1-8539, for extracting and supplying raw materials in a raw material container equipped with a filter with hot water. is there.

In general, the raw material container is formed in a cartridge shape, and when the beverage is extracted, the holder in which the raw material container is set is closely attached to the main body so as to be located below the hot water supply device, and then the hot water is added to the raw material container. After the extraction, the holder is removed from the main body and the raw material container is replaced.

(C) Problem to be Solved by the Invention The holder in which the raw material container is set is attached in close contact with the main body by an appropriate contact mechanism, but there is a problem that alignment and face-to-face alignment become troublesome at the time of attachment.

Therefore, the present invention provides a beverage supply device in which a fixing member for locking the holder in the main body is provided with a guide member to facilitate the attachment of the holder.

(E) Action The holder in which the raw material container is set is moved along the guide member, and one of the hooks is pushed until it is locked in the groove. Then, when one of the hooks is locked in the groove, the holder is fitted into the fixture and further rotated along the inner peripheral surface of the fixture, the other hook is also locked in the groove and fitted. Complete. As a result, the holder in which the raw material container is set is closely attached to the main body, and the extraction is effectively performed by supplying hot water.

When the extraction is complete, remove the holder from the fixture and replace the raw material container in the reverse order.

(F) Embodiment FIG. 1 and FIG. 2 show the constitution of the beverage supply device according to the present invention. In the figure, the main body 1 is located above the hot water tank 2
And a tray 1A for placing the cup 3 to which the extracted beverage is supplied is provided below.

The holder 4 which is detachable from the main body 1 is composed of a handle portion 4A and an annular portion 4B, and the raw material container 5 is provided in the hollow portion of the annular portion 4B.
Is set. (Fig. 3). This raw material container 5 is an annular part
It is shaped like a cartridge so that it can be easily set in 4B, has a filter 6 on the bottom surface, and stores the extraction raw material inside. The holder 4 is attached to the fixture 9 fixed to the main body 1 in a state where the raw material container 5 is set. When the holder 4 is attached to the fixture 9, the raw material container 5 supported by the annular portion 4B of the holder 4 is attached. Will be located below the hot water supply device 12. The hot water supply device 12 is provided with a hot water injection port 21 at the top, a plurality of injection ports 23 provided at the bottom surface, and a packing 20 is provided at the peripheral portion of the bottom surface.

The mechanism by which the holder 4 is attached to the fixture 9 will be described with reference to FIGS. 3 to 9.

The fixture 9 has a hollow portion 9B that substantially matches the outer circumference of the annular portion 4B of the holder-4, and the inner circumference that will face the outer circumferential portion of the annular portion 4B when the holder 4 is mounted. Grooves 13 are formed on the surface by providing protrusions 15 along the inner circumference. A pair of hooks 14A, 14B provided on the outer peripheral portion of the annular portion 4B of the holder 4 are locked in the groove portion 13. Hooks 14A, 14B
Are arranged so as to face each other across the hollow portion along the direction a of the arrow for inserting the holder 4 into the main body 1.
14A and the handle portion 4A are provided on the same side. Then, the protrusion 15 is cut out at a portion facing the hooking tool 14A when the holder 4 is inserted into the fixing tool 9 in the direction of arrow a so that the hooking tool 14A escapes when the holder 4 is fitted to the fixing tool 9. The part 16 (FIG. 9) is formed. Further, a guide member 17 for guiding the movement when the holder 4 is inserted is provided below the fixture 9. The guide member 17 has a surface that contacts the lower surface of the holder 4, and this surface is fixed with a certain inclination so that the hooking tool 14B engages with the groove portion 13 when the holder 4 is inserted in the direction a. It is attached to the tool 9.

In order to attach the holder 4 to the fixture 9, the holder 4 is first placed on the guide member 17 (Fig. 3) and pushed in the direction of arrow a. As a result, the holder 4 moves along the inclined surface of the guide member 17, and the hooking tool 14B engages with the groove 13 (fourth
Figure) When the holder 4 is lifted upward with this engagement as a fulcrum, the hooking tool 14A enters the hollow portion 9B of the fixing tool 9 through the escape portion 16 and the holder 4 is fitted into the fixing tool 9 (Fig. 5). After that, when the handle portion 4A is rotated in the arrow direction b (FIGS. 6 and 8), the hooking tool 14A also moves in the groove portion 13A.
The fitting between the fixture 9 and the holder 4 is completed. In this state, the hooks 14A and 14B are both supported by the projection 15 and the groove 1
It is locked to 3 and is completely sealed by the packing 20.

When the switch 7 is operated with the holder 4 attached to the main body 1, the peristaltic pump 8 is driven to suck the hot water in the hot water tank 2 through the siphon tube 9 and the suction pipe line 10, and further discharge pipes. Hot water supply device 12 through path 11
Is pressure-fed to the raw material container 5. This perista pump 8
In the configuration, the flexible tube 8B is rolled by the rotation of the rotating body 8A to push out the liquid in the tube. As a result, the hot water pumped into the raw material container 5 is mixed with the extraction raw material, passes through the filter 6, and is supplied to the cup 3 as an extracted beverage.

After the beverage is extracted, the holder 4 is removed in the reverse operation, but the raw material container 5 set in the holder 4 is discarded. In the standby state, the holder 4 may be placed on the guide member 17, and the lower end of the holder 4 may be held by the main body 1 in a state of being locked by the stopper 21 (FIG. 7).

(G) Effect of the Invention According to the present invention, by inserting the holder in which the raw material container is set into the main body along the guide member, the holder can be easily attached to the fixture. Therefore, when the holder is inserted into the fixture, troublesome face-to-face alignment and position alignment are unnecessary, and a beverage brewing device with excellent operability is provided.
